#020cd4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#020cd4 is composed of 0.8% red, 4.7%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.1% cyan, 94.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 237.1 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 42%. #020cd4 color hex could be obtained by blending #0418ff with #0000a9.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

Shades and Tints of #020cd4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000112 is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#020cd4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656571 is the less saturated color, while #020cd4 is the most saturated one.
